Synthesis, structure, and properties of rare-earth germanium sulfide iodides RE3Ge2S8I (RE = La, Ce, Pr)
2019
Abstract The rare-earth germanium sulfide iodides RE 3 Ge 2 S 8 I ( RE = La, Ce, Pr) have been prepared by reaction of the elements at 900 °C. They adopt the monoclinic La 3 (SiO 4 ) 2 Cl-type structure (space group C 2/ c , Z = 4; a = 16.156(4)–15.9760(9) A, b = 7.9776(18)–7.8786(5) A, c = 11.081(3)–10.9281(6) A, β = 98.192(5)–98.4525(10)° on progressing from La to Pr for the RE component) consisting of isolated thiogermanate tetrahedral groups [GeS 4 ] 4– separated by RE 3+ and I − ions. The optical band gaps fall in the range of 2.7–3.1 eV. Magnetic measurements indicated simple paramagnetic behaviour for Ce 3 Ge 2 S 8 I and Pr 3 Ge 2 S 8 I.
